Readers' Choice: The Shamrock Voted Best Place for St. Paddy's Day

Irish pub claims second straight Patch choice award.

This week, Patch asked readers to vote for where in town is the best place to spend St. Patrick's Day in Huntington.

After days of voting, readers ultimately selected  as the place to be Irish for a day.

The Shamrock dominated voting with 64 percent of all votes cast. Other contenders like Finnegan's and Finley's of Green Street faired well.

It was the  for The Shamrock which was selected by readers as the best place to get chicken wings in Huntington last month. After more than three decades in Huntington, the pub has built quite a following.

"That's why we tell everybody that we are Huntington's best kept secret," said restaurant owner Kevin Morrison, thankful for the support. "It's nice that people feel the way they do."

"We've been around a long time, 33 years of fans!" said executive chef Joe Russo, Morrison's son-in-law.

Big crowds are expected on St. Patrick's Day.

Russo said Saturday's menu includes Irish specialties such as sheppard's pie, fish and chips, salmon dishes, Irish potato leak soup and traditional corned beef and cabbage.
